Integrin alpha-11 is a protein that in humans is encoded by the ITGA11 gene.This gene encodes an alpha integrin. Integrins are heterodimeric integral membrane proteins composed of an alpha chain and a beta chain. This protein contains an I domain is expressed in muscle tissue dimerizes with beta 1 integrin in vitro and appears to bind collagen in this form. Therefore the protein may be involved in attaching muscle tissue to the extracellular matrix.
